## Deployment

Schemaforge runs as a single stateless binary behind the internal gateway. Deploy via the standard pipeline; no manual steps. Registry state lives in the backing store, so rolling restarts are safe. Do not run two writers against one store — compatibility checks assume a single sequencer. Health endpoint must pass before traffic shifts. Migrations apply automatically on boot; failures abort startup, which is intentional. Logs go to the shared sink. The deployment reads the following configuration at startup:

deployment values, fahap-hahaf:
[casdor]
port = 9200
region = south-2
host = casdor.qirvanworks.corp
timeout_ms = 3000
retries = 4

## Build Provenance: The Great FD Hunt

Quick recap for the sync: the Larkspool build agents kept running out of file descriptors mid-compile. Turns out a leaked FD in the artifact uploader survived across jobs, so provenance records pointed at half-written tarballs. Mira patched the uploader to close handles explicitly. The fix landed in the following build.

session token of kageg-tahop = htk14_af3c1ccccb7dcf

Step 3. Deploy the batched-loader fix for the Quillmarsh GraphQL API. The patch replaces per-node resolver calls with a dataloader, eliminating the N+1 pattern on the orders connection. Verify QUILL_BATCH_WINDOW_MS=8 is set. The loader caches through the Bramblewick edge cache, which now requires an authenticated connection; anonymous mode was removed in 2.9. Confirm the cache host resolves from the deploy box. Then add this line to the service's .env.

env line for kageg-fajof: COURIER_KEY5=93d14

Ticket FW-providence: Firmware channel vault locked

The vault holding signing material for the Larkspur device-firmware update channel locked itself after three failed attempts during onboarding. New team members: do not retry credentials; each failure extends the lockout. Use the documented recovery flow instead. The vault accepts the recovery passphrase noted directly below.

vault phrase of tawig-taduf = zorath-oliwyn